Space Monkey Reflects: The Essence of We-lco-me

In the welcoming embrace of a garden entrance adorned with blooming flowers and lush greenery, we stand before a sign that reads “We-lco-me.” This simple yet profound word captures the essence of unity, love, clarity, and oneness. It is a celebration of the interconnectedness that binds us all, reminding us that to feel welcome is to acknowledge both the individual and the collective.

The word “welcome” itself is a beautiful tapestry of meanings. It contains “we” and “me,” signifying the balance between our individuality and our shared existence. The inclusion of “lco” invites us to explore deeper layers of meaning—perhaps “Love, Clarity, Oneness.” These elements are the pillars that support our sense of belonging and connection.

As we stand at the threshold of this harmonious space, we are greeted by figures extending their hands in a gesture of warmth and acceptance. Among them, a female figure stands prominently, her smile radiating kindness and her presence symbolizing the nurturing aspect of welcome. The sunlight streaming through the trees casts a golden glow, enhancing the atmosphere of serenity and invitation.

To feel welcome is to know that both we and me desire to be together. It is an acknowledgment of our shared humanity and the unique contributions each of us brings to the collective whole. In this garden, we find a sanctuary where our differences are celebrated and our commonalities are embraced.

The concept of “We-lco-me” reminds us that true welcome extends beyond mere physical presence. It encompasses an emotional and spiritual acceptance, a recognition that each person is valued and cherished. This welcoming spirit fosters an environment where love, clarity, and oneness can flourish.

Love is the foundation of any welcoming space. It is the force that binds us, transcending barriers and creating bonds that are both deep and enduring. In the garden, love is palpable, infusing the air with a sense of peace and connection. It is through love that we find the courage to open our hearts to others and to embrace the full spectrum of human experience.

Clarity emerges from this loving environment. It is the clarity of knowing who we are and where we belong. When we feel

welcome, we gain a clearer understanding of our purpose and our place in the world. This clarity allows us to navigate our lives with confidence and grace, assured in the knowledge that we are part of something greater than ourselves.

Oneness is the culmination of love and clarity. It is the realization that we are all interconnected, that the boundaries between us are illusory. In this state of oneness, we transcend the limitations of the individual ego and experience the profound unity of all existence. The garden, with its harmonious blend of nature and humanity, serves as a perfect metaphor for this oneness.

As we walk the path into the garden, we are reminded that welcome is both a gift and a practice. It is something we receive and something we give. By embracing the spirit of welcome, we create spaces where others can feel seen, heard, and valued. We cultivate environments where love, clarity, and oneness can thrive.

The act of welcoming others also deepens our own sense of belonging. It is through the act of extending a hand, of opening our hearts, that we reinforce our connection to the broader community. In this way, welcome becomes a cycle of giving and receiving, a continuous flow of energy that enriches all who participate.

In this garden, under the sign of “We-lco-me,” we find a powerful reminder of the importance of creating inclusive and loving spaces. Whether in our homes, our communities, or our own hearts, the spirit of welcome has the power to transform. It invites us to be both the giver and receiver of love, clarity, and oneness.

So, let us embrace the essence of “We-lco-me” in all that we do. Let us create spaces where every person feels valued and connected, where love flows freely, and where clarity and oneness guide our actions. In doing so, we honor the profound truth that we are all interconnected, and we celebrate the beauty of our shared journey.
